Selby leisure centre showcased at public event
Selby District Council will showcase plans for the replacement Abbey Leisure centre complex - which was destroyed by fire last year.
The new facilities will take around 30 months to complete with the old centre in the process old being demolished.
Plans intend to have a footprint of 1,851sq metres (19,900sq feet) - nearly half that of the previous building.
The new centre will feature a larger gym, six-lane swimming pool and an outdoor all-weather sports pitch.
The plans, which will reportedly cost around £9m (US$13.6m, €10.5m) will resemble "a simple, crisp box", with large windows around the building, including a seven-metre-high window looking into the pool.
Plans for a replacement centre are subject to planning application to be considered on 31 July.
